For clarification: the acid in sauerkraut is not vinegar but lactic acid. It is not added to the cabbage but is made from fermenting the cabbage itself. Some sauerkraut has wine added to it for flavour.

Serving everything with sauerkraut and red cabbage seems more like an American thing to me. Of course I don't know how they do it in other places in Germany, but where I live, the equivalent to rice and beans would definitely be potatoes. Sauerkraut and red cabbage are just a side dish served along with certain meals. Schnitzel is usually eaten with potatoes or fries, and often some type of sauce. Also, personally, I grew up with red cabbage being served a lot. We had sauerkraut only on very few occasions.
